Northumberland County Braithwaite Bridge Rehabilitation

Industry Name: Heavy/Highway/Utilities

Trade Name: Bridges/Pedestrian Bridges

Project Street: County Road 24

Project City: Roseneath

Detail Of Services: The project includes the Rehabilitation of Braithwaite Bridge, located on County Road 24,approximately 1.8km north-east of County Road 24 in the Township of Alnwick/Haldimand near the Village of Roseneath. Braithwaite Bride is located at google coordinates 44.198238, -78.036847. Braithwaite Bridge is a single span, two lane, concrete rigid frame bridge with a concrete deck and an asphalt wearing surface. Construction includes full depth removal of the asphalt surface, scarify the deck top, full depth removal of the concrete curbs and barrier system and partial depth concrete patch repairs to soffit and substructure. Construction also includes placing concrete deck overlay, waterproofing the bridge deck, paving the bridge deck, installation of barrier wall, installation of curb and gutter and installation of outlet treatments. Construction is to also include all approach roadway grading including the placement of roadway granular, hot mix asphalt, steel beam guiderail, and embankment rock protection.

Fort Frances 52 Canadians Arena Electrical System Replacement

Industry Name: Leisure/Parks/Recreation

Trade Name: Arenas/Stadiums

Project Street: 740 Scott St.

Project City: Fort Frances

Detail Of Services: 52 Canadians Arena Electrical System Replacement52 Canadians Arena is an ice rink within the Fort Frances Memorial Sports Complex. 52 Canadians Arena currently has a separate electrical service than the rest of the sport complex. Most of the electrical panels and other electrical equipment at 52 Canadians Arena are original to the construction of the building and are in poor condition. The existing service entrance transformers are approaching the end of their useful service life and do not meet code requirements of local authorities having jurisdiction. The scope of work for this project involves replacing the aging electrical distribution with new equipment and combining the 52 Canadians Arena electrical service with the rest of the Fort Frances Memorial Sports complex such that the 52Canadians Arena electrical service adheres to the guidelines of local authorities having jurisdiction and the overall electrical distribution organization within the facility is improved.

Clarington Port Darlington Boat Launch & Parking Lot Reconstruction

Industry Name: Water/Marine Construction

Trade Name: Docks/Piers/Breakwaters

Project Street: South of West Beach Road

Project City: Bowmanville

Detail Of Services: The Municipality of Clarington is seeking a qualified company to complete the reconstruction of the Port Darlington Boat Launch ramp and parking lot located adjacent to Bowmanville Creek, immediately south of West Beach Road in Bowmanville. All work is to be completed in accordance with the terms, conditions and specifications contained within the tender document. The scope of works include:· Reconstruction of the boat launch ramp including existing ramp removal, clearing / grubbing, earthworks, reinforced concrete ramp installation (above waterline), installation of precast concrete block panels (below waterline) and general area restoration.· Fabrication and installation of a timber staircase from the parking lot to the boat launch ramp.· Preparation of area and installation of mounting components for the installation of the cantilever docks. Dock installation to be completed by third party.· Reconstruction of the parking lot and access road including existing fencing and signage removals, earthworks, swale construction, ditching, pulverization of existing asphalt surface, fine grading and granular placement, placement of asphalt surface, parking curb installation, signage, line painting, garbage unit installation and landscape plantings.· Reconstruction of a small segment of the Waterfront Trail multi-use path to facilitate grading transitions.
